Troubleshooting

Before taking your machine in for service at your Baby Lock retailer, check the following:
Condition
The machine fails to
start:
Thread breaks:
Skipped stitches:
1. Are electrical plugs properly connected?
2. Is foot control plug properly connected?
3. Is the main power switch on?
4. Is the side cover open?
5. Has the presser foot lever been lowered?
6. Is the latch wire in the release position?
7. Check household circuit breaker or fuse.
8. Is the bobbin winder disengaged?
1. Is the bobbin case threaded properly?
2. Is the bobbin case loaded properly?
3. Is the needle inserted correctly?
4. Is the needle bent, broken, and/or worn?
5. Thread is knotted, tangled or of poor quality.
6. Are you using the correct thread weight
for machine?
7. Is the needle being used the Organ QKx1system?
8. Is the latch wire bent, broke, and/or worn?
9. Is the latch wire in the center channel of needle?
10. Is the shuttle hook free of lint and bits of thread?
11. Spool cap is not properly attached
and/or the correct size for thread spool.
1. Is the needle bent, broke, and/or worn?
2. Is the latch wire bent, broke, and/or worn?
3. Is the needle inserted correctly?
4. Is the bobbin case threaded properly?
5. Is the bobbin case loaded properly?
6. Is the presser foot pressure dial set correctly for
the type of fabric?
7. ls the presser foot height adjustment dial set cor-
rectly?
8. Is the needle being used the Organ QKx1system?
9. Is the fabric being pushed or pulled while sewing?
10. Is the shuttle hook free of lint and bits of thread?
